Historic hotel details uncovered during Cleethorpes restoration

A lesser-known layer of Cleethorpes’ past has come to light during restoration works at one of the town’s oldest buildings. The Dolphin Hotel, originally known as the Cleethorpes Hotel, dates back nearly 250 years and is undergoing extensive external restoration as part of wider regeneration activity in the seaside town.
